Toronto International Porn Festival Begins Friday

TORONTO — Good for Her presents the Toronto International Porn Festival, which runs Friday through Sunday.

This year’s festival will include panels and screenings throughout the weekend at The Royal Cinema and Super Wonder Gallery, both in downtown Toronto. The weekend culminates in an awards ceremony on Sunday evening.

This will be the second year of the Toronto International Porn Festival and include films from Bruce LaBruce and Shine Louise Houston, among many others. All accepted submissions have confirmed that their film production adhered to APAC’s Model Bill of Rights.

In 2006, Toronto adult store Good for Her launched the Feminist Porn Awards to bring attention to and celebrate the shifts in the porn industry towards more ethical, feminist porn. After many successful years, the festival rebranded to its current form, the Toronto International Porn Festival.
